Output 38fa976bc366d43ac89f8e962bc6baec2df72d179baafea76d86f0e0d0fb8a40:1

value
43445
script pubkey
OP_0 OP_PUSHBYTES_20 625c9f56a3287e682a358747140fd4ffc0823a62
address
bc1qvfwf744r9plxs234sar3gr75llqgywnzgxmux7
transaction
38fa976bc366d43ac89f8e962bc6baec2df72d179baafea76d86f0e0d0fb8a40
confirmations
24394
spent
true